Essential Ingredients

Here’s what you’ll need to make this delicious dish:

  • Boneless, Skinless Chicken Breasts: Tender chicken pieces are perfect for stir frying; slice them thinly for quicker cooking.

  • Fresh Broccoli Florets: Select bright green florets; they should be firm and fresh to ensure crunchiness.

  • Garlic: Minced garlic adds an aromatic punch; use fresh cloves for the best flavor.

  • Ginger: Grated ginger gives warmth to the stir fry; opt for fresh for a zingy kick.

  • Soy Sauce: Low-sodium soy sauce helps control saltiness while enhancing umami flavors in the dish.

  • Sesame Oil: This oil provides an aromatic finish; drizzle it in at the end for depth.

  • Vegetable Oil: Use this for high-heat cooking; it helps achieve that sought-after stir-fry sizzle.

  • Cornstarch: A little cornstarch mixed with water acts as a thickener for your sauce; it keeps everything glossy.

  • Sliced Bell Peppers (optional): Colorful peppers add sweetness and crunch; feel free to toss them in if you have some!

  • Cooked Rice or Noodles (for serving): Serve over fluffy rice or slurp-worthy noodles to complete your meal.

Let’s Make it Together

Prepare Your Ingredients: Gather all your ingredients and have them preppedβ€”chop chicken into strips, mince garlic and ginger, and wash broccoli florets.

Heat Your Pan: In a large skillet or wok, heat vegetable oil over medium-high heat until shimmering. This is where the magic happens!

Add Chicken Delightfully: Throw in the sliced chicken breasts, stirring frequently until they turn golden brownβ€”about 5 minutesβ€”then remove from pan.

Aromatics Time!: In the same pan, add minced garlic and grated ginger. SautΓ© until fragrantβ€”about 30 secondsβ€”watching closely so they don’t burn!

Toss in Broccoli & Peppers: Add broccoli florets (and bell peppers if using) to the pan with a splash of water to steam slightlyβ€”cook for about 3 minutes until vibrant green.

Create Your Sauce Magic!: Return chicken to the pan along with soy sauce mixed with cornstarch slurry. Stir everything together until glossy and heated throughβ€”about 2 minutes.

Storing & Reheating

Store le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for up to three days. To reheat, use a skillet over medium heat until warmed through, ensuring the chicken remains juicy and tender.

Chef's Helpful Tips

  • For optimal taste, cook your chicken in batches if needed; overcrowding leads to steaming rather than searing
  • Ensure your vegetables are prepped and ready before you start cookingβ€”this saves time and maintains freshness

How do I ensure my chicken stays tender?

Marinate your chicken for at least 30 minutes before cooking for maximum tenderness.

Can I use frozen broccoli instead?

Yes, just make sure to thaw it completely before stir-frying for even cooking.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 lb boneless, skinless chicken breasts
  • 2 cups fresh broccoli florets
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 inch ginger, grated
  • ΒΌ cup low-sodium soy sauce
  • 1 tsp sesame oil
  • 2 tbsp vegetable oil
  • 1 tbsp cornstarch mixed with 2 tbsp water (for thickening)
  • 1 cup sliced bell peppers (optional)
  • Cooked rice or noodles for serving

Instructions

  1. Prepare ingredients: Slice chicken into strips, mince garlic and ginger, and wash broccoli florets.
  2. Heat vegetable oil in a large skillet or wok over medium-high heat until shimmering.
  3. Add sliced chicken; stir frequently until golden brown (about 5 minutes). Remove from the pan.
  4. In the same pan, sautΓ© minced garlic and grated ginger for about 30 seconds until fragrant.
  5. Toss in broccoli (and bell peppers if using) with a splash of water; cook for about 3 minutes until vibrant green.
  6. Return chicken to the pan along with soy sauce and cornstarch slurry; stir to coat and heat through (about 2 minutes).
  • Prep Time: 10 minutes
  • Cook Time: 15 minutes
